Champagne Deutz was founded in 1838 by William Deutz and Pierre-Hubert Geldermann. It owns 42 hectares of its own vineyards (quite unusual in a region where contract growing is the norm) and sources fruit from a further 200 hectares of vineyards in some of Champagne's finest crus, using only the first pressings from these grapes. In addition to holdings in Bordeaux and the Rhône Valley, Deutz produces sparkling wine in the Marlborough region of New Zealand. It was also a favourite wine of Queen Victoria!
Grapes are pressed using Coquard basket presses, only the first press being used. Each plot is vinified separately, fermenting in small, 10,000-litre tanks, at 18-20˚C for two weeks. All of the wine undergoes malolactic conversion, and it is allowed to age for a minimum of three years. The assemblage will include up to 40 different growths, and between 20 and 40% reserve wines.
The wine is gold-coloured with initial floral aromas giving way to more familiar notes of toast and pears. A full-bodied palate maintains the crisp freshness of Chardonnay with the voluptuous richness of PInot Noir.
